Greater Lansing Food Banks We Serve Kids Program works to ensure children grades K-8 have access to nutritious foodon weekends and extended breaks when school meals are not available. A typical backpack includes easy-to-prepare items such as: macaroni & cheese, apple sauce packs, peanut butter, canned vegetables, pasta with protein, granola bars, fruit snacks, canned soup and more. Interested in a career with Cohoes Food Services? Free Meal Benefit Free and Reduced eligible students will be allowed to receive a free breakfast and lunch meal of their choice each day. School staff shall deal directly with parents/guardians regarding unpaid school meal fees. The Cohoes City School Districts point-of-sale system (nutri-kids) will track all charges and payments. School staff will make two documented attempts to reach out to parents/guardians to complete a meal application in addition to the application and instructions provided in the school enrollment packet.
